Пошаговая интеграция SonarQube в облачную сборку
введите здесь описание изображения. Я интегрировал свой github с облачной сборкой Google, чтобы автоматически создавать образы докеров. В качестве следующего шага я хочу добавить шаги в свой cloudbuild.yml, чтобы запустить сканирование образа докера с помощью сонаркуба.
Мой файл облачной сборки выглядит как прикрепленное изображение
изображений:
- 'gcr.io/project-one-315608/project-one-gcp'
Я получаю указанную ниже ошибку, из-за которой не удалось выполнить шаг 3 -
ОШИБКА: этап сборки 3 «gcr.io/project-one-315608/sonar-scanner:latest» завершился неудачно: этап завершился с ненулевым статусом: 9 ОШИБКА Завершенный этап № 3 Шаг № 3: узел: неверный параметр: -Dsonar. источники =. Шаг № 3: узел: неверный вариант: -Dsonar.projectKey=JoS-Marvel_Project-one-GCP Шаг № 3: узел: неверный параметр: -Dsonar.login=eff2c78ae9fa629347b491ec50873f896615cd0f Шаг № 3: узел: неверный параметр: -Dsonar.host.url=https://sonarcloud.io/ Шаг № 3: gcr.io/project-one-315608/sonar-scanner:latest
Какие модификации нужны моему файлу YML?